The procedure with HenryMeds begins with the patient finishing a medical consumption form online, which normally takes 10 inutes. This is followed by scheduling and attending a telehealth visit with a licensed provider by means of Doxy, normally within 1-2 days. As soon as the assessment is complete, the service provider reviews the case and authorizes the prescription within 24 hours.
Medications are filled by partner intensifying drug stores, such as Hallandale Drug store, and can also be sent to a drug store of the patient’s option, though prices might differ. After approval, the medications are normally delivered within 7-10 business days. Clients get tracking info to keep an eye on the shipment status.
The whole procedure, from initial consumption to receiving the medication, usually takes 1-2 weeks. While many users discover the procedure hassle-free and budget-friendly, some have actually reported problems with customer service and delivery hold-ups. Proactive communication with customer care is recommended to fix any concerns without delay.

Outcomes will differ based on everything from diet and exercise to genetics, and the length of time you remain on the drug can affect your results, too. However it’s clear that the clinical evidence available, of which there is plenty, points toward working for weight reduction.
So, why does not semaglutide score a 10 out of 10? Well, part of the issue is the lack of proof surrounding the doses Henry utilizes in its oral preparations. The injectable version lines up precisely with a lot of medical research studies and the routine utilized by Ozempic and Wegovy. However the guidelines for oral preparations are less clear.
A branded type of oral tablets offers under the trademark name Rybelsus and offers a 3mg everyday tablet. And research into the oral version typically involves 3mg, 7mg, and 14mg dosages.5 Henry’s sublingual drops and dissolving tablets only offer 1mg each day. However, because they at first soak up through oral membranes, bypassing the stomach to go straight to the blood stream, they should not need as high of a dosage.6 Research indicates a particular amount of trouble absorbing peptides through routine digestion, so sublingual absorption might show exceptional.7.
The only issue is that sublingual shipment systems for semaglutide have not been evaluated to establish an effective dosage beyond the compounding drug store market’s internal publications, which are more marketing materials than clinical research.
Our testers experienced what significantly resembled efficacy from 1mg of the sublingual drops, but there’s nothing to show this will be a normal experience.

In the UK, -like drugs have been prescribed on the NHS (free of cost) to people with type 2 diabetes, or when the drug has actually been considered clinically needed.
Yet much like in the United States, the sales of British online merchants consisting of drug stores and charm companies have actually boomed, as they have actually offered the weekly injection option to those wishing to shed excess weight, at rates as low as about , 72 ($ 92) a month. The consequence is that too many people (including those whose weight doesn’t present any health threats) are taking the drug who do not require it.
Oftentimes they do not understand how it operates in the body, or its side effects. An A&E physician just recently cautioned that young women exist with potentially deadly problems from using the drug to achieve weight loss.
However -type drugs come with potential adverse effects such as queasiness and stomach pain, and may be implicated in gallbladder issues, kidney damage, pancreatitis and thyroid cancer, although research study is ongoing. They can likewise cause unwanted visual impacts, such as “Ozempic face” where the skin droops and wrinkles. And eventually we don’t know the long-lasting health effects because the drugs have remained in widespread usage for less than a years.
Another downside is that the drugs require to be taken continually, otherwise the weight lost through the suppression of appetite might be restored. For instance, one research study found that once people stopped taking, they restored two-thirds of their weight within a year. Users are registering for a weekly injection for the rest of their lives.
